Typical Issues with Ignition Keys
Before diving into the repair process, it's important to grasp the typical problems connected with ignition keys. These may consist of:
Bending or breaking: Keys are typically made of metal, which can flex or break under stress.Worn-out key: Over time, the grooves and cuts on keys may wear down, leading to difficulty when beginning the engine.Transponder issues: Modern ignition secrets are typically equipped with transponder chips that communicate with the car's computer system. If the chip is harmed or not functioning, the lorry may not begin.Ignition cylinder failure: Sometimes the issue lies not with the key itself however with the ignition cylinder, which might use out gradually or end up being harmed due to foreign things.Table: Common Ignition Key Problems and CausesIssuePossible CausesFlexing or breakingExtreme force, faulty ignition mechanismWorn-out keyFrequent usage, direct exposure to componentsTransponder chip breakdownDamage to chip, electrical disturbanceIgnition cylinder failureWear and tear, foreign object obstructionThe Repair Process
Fixing ignition keys can include numerous steps, depending on the nature of the problem. Here's a breakdown of the typical repair process:
Assess the Damage: The primary step is to recognize the particular problem with the ignition key. This can normally be figured out through a visual examination and by attempting to begin the lorry.
Determine the Type of Key: It's essential to know whether the key is a conventional metal key, a transponder key, or a smart key, as this affects the repair approach.
Repair or Replace: Once the kind of key and the nature of the issue are identified, the next action is to decide whether to repair or replace the key. This decision can depend on various aspects, such as cost and seriousness of damage.
Reprogramming (if suitable): For keys with transponder chips, reprogramming might be essential after repair or replacement. This can typically be done at a dealership or by a qualified locksmith.
Checking: Finally, once repairs are completed, the key needs to be checked to make sure that it operates properly with the ignition system.

How much does ignition key repair cost?
Repair expenses can differ extensively depending upon the severity of the damage and the type of key. Small repairs can vary from ₤ 10 to ₤ 50, while transponder key replacements might vary from ₤ 150 to ₤ 300.
Can I fix my ignition key myself?
Small issues, such as superficial bends, can in some cases be fixed at home. Nevertheless, more complicated issues, such as electronic breakdowns, ought to be dealt with by a professional.
What should I do if my key breaks inside the ignition?
If a key breaks inside the ignition, it is encouraged to speak with a locksmith or an expert mechanic to safely draw out the damaged piece without damaging the ignition cylinder.
The length of time does it take to repair an ignition key?
Simple repairs can typically be finished within a number of hours, while replacements or reprogramming might take longer, especially at dealers.
What type of ignition keys can be repaired?
The majority of traditional metal secrets can be repaired. Smart and transponder secrets might require more specialized services but can normally be reprogrammed or changed.
